Perhaps you can try descaling your kettle. You can either purchase a descaler or put 1/3 white vinegar + 2/3 water in the kettle and boil that. Leave the solution in the kettle overnight after boiling. The next day, dump out the vinegar solution and boil with just water. Leave that overnight and rinse out the kettle and you can use the kettle for making hot beverages now.

If a kettle is not descaled regularly, mineral deposits from hard water can build up and reduce its efficiency. This can lead to longer boiling times, increased energy consumption, and potentially damage the heating element over time. The mineral deposits can also affect the taste of the water boiled in the kettle.
To get rid of the metal taste in a kettle, try boiling a mixture of equal parts water and vinegar in the kettle. Let it sit for a few hours, then rinse thoroughly with clean water. Repeat as necessary until the metal taste is gone.

The time taken for a kettle to boil will vary based on factors such as the power of the kettle, the amount of water being boiled, and the starting temperature of the water. To calculate the time, you can use the formula: time = (energy needed to heat water) / (power of the kettle). This formula takes into account the specific heat capacity of water and the efficiency of the kettle.
